谷歌浏览器中的开发者工具介绍
在现代网页开发和调试中,浏览器的开发者工具扮演着重要的角色。谷歌浏览器(Google Chrome)作为市场上最流行的浏览器之一,其内置的开发者工具(DevTools)更是提供了丰富的功能,帮助开发者和设计师高效地定位和解决问题。本文将对谷歌浏览器中的开发者工具进行详细介绍,帮助你充分利用这一强大的工具。
一、打开开发者工具
在谷歌浏览器中,打开开发者工具的方式非常简单。用户可以通过右键点击网页并选择“检查”选项,或者直接使用快捷键Ctrl + Shift + I(Windows)或Command + Option + I(Mac)打开。此外,你也可以通过浏览器菜单,依次选择“更多工具” > “开发者工具”来打开。
二、主要面板及其功能
1. 元素(Elements)
元素面板显示了当前网页的DOM结构和样式信息。在这个面板中,开发者可以查看和编辑HTML元素以及其对应的CSS样式。通过点击页面上的元素,可以在这一面板中直接看到所选元素的详细信息。开发者可以实时修改HTML和CSS,从而即时预览更改效果,这对于设计调整和响应式布局测试尤为重要。
2. 控制台(Console)
控制台是开发者与浏览器之间的互动窗口。它不仅可以显示JavaScript中的错误和日志信息,还允许开发者直接执行JavaScript代码。在调试时,开发者可以利用控制台输出变量的值、查看函数的执行情况,或者手动调用某些功能。这对于定位问题和测试代码片段非常便利。
3. 网络(Network)
网络面板用于监控网页加载时的所有网络请求。开发者可以查看页面加载所需的所有资源,包括HTML、CSS、JavaScript、图片等文件的加载时间、状态码和响应数据。通过分析网络请求,开发者可以优化页面性能,确保资源的高效加载。此面板同样支持过滤和搜索功能,便于快速定位特定请求。
4. 性能(Performance)
性能面板用于分析网页的运行性能。开发者可以记录网页的加载过程和交互响应,并观察各项操作的执行时间。此面板提供了详细的时间线视图,帮助开发者识别性能瓶颈,优化网页运行效率。利用这一功能,开发者可以确保网站在各种设备上的流畅体验。
5. 应用程序(Application)
应用程序面板主要用于查看和管理网页的存储数据,包括Cookies、Local Storage、Session Storage以及IndexedDB等。在这里,开发者可以方便地查看、编辑和删除存储的数据,有助于管理应用程序的状态和用户数据。
6. 安全性(Security)
安全性面板提供有关网站安全性的信息,包括SSL证书的有效性和任何潜在安全问题的警告。开发者可以通过此面板来检查HTTPS连接是否安全,有效地保护用户数据和隐私。
三、其他实用功能
除了以上主要面板外,谷歌浏览器开发者工具还提供了许多其他的实用功能。例如,设备模式允许开发者模拟不同设备的屏幕尺寸和用户代理,从而测试响应式设计;样式编辑器则提供了CSS样式的实时编辑和预览功能;快照工具支持对页面进行快照和保存便于后续分析。
总之,谷歌浏览器的开发者工具是一个功能强大且不可或缺的工具,帮助开发者在网页开发和调试过程中更加高效。通过灵活运用这些工具,开发者不仅可以提升代码质量,还能优化用户体验,使网站在各个方面达到最佳表现。无论你是新手还是经验丰富的开发者,熟练掌握开发者工具无疑是提升工作效率的重要一步。